The news this morning – the publication of the Financial System Inquiry’s recommendations – is yet another reminder of the dominance of Australia’s major banks. The ‘big four’ account for 78% of owner-occupied mortgages, hence the FSI urging APRA to adjust risk weighting to favour smaller operators.
